linux下apache添加php libphp5.so

运行apache提示错误httpd:Syntaxerroronline53of/usr/local/httpd/conf/httpd.conf:Cannotload/us... 运行apache提示错误httpd: Syntax error on line 53 of /usr/local/httpd/conf/httpd.conf: Cannot load /usr/local/httpd/modules/libphp5.so into server: libmysqlclient.so.16: cannot open shared object file: No such file or directory

http.conf中添加了如下:

LoadModule php5_module modules/libphp5.so
AddType application/x-httpd-php .php .phtml
AddType application/x-httpd-php-source .phps

/usr/local/httpd/modules里有libphp5.so。

请教高手啊,或者告诉我可能是什么原因引起的,这个问题是怎么回事?
我发现我的mysql-5.0.41安装好没有libmysqlclient.so.16,只有libmysqlclient.so.15。是mysql的版本问题么?
展开
 我来答
jiangtao9999
2010-03-26 · TA获得超过1.2万个赞
知道大有可为答主
回答量:1.2万
采纳率:44%
帮助的人:8130万
展开全部
libmysqlclient.so.16: cannot open shared object file: No such file or directory

人家说的是没有找到 libmysqlclient.so.16 。
也就是你的 php 安装有问题,导致依赖不满足,apache 无法调用 libphp5.so
这个 libmysqlclient.so.16 应该在 mtsql-client 包里面。

这个问题充分说明:你看错教程了。
dawnco
2010-03-26 · TA获得超过324个赞
知道小有建树答主
回答量:789
采纳率:0%
帮助的人:405万
展开全部
你看下 .
/usr/local/httpd/modules/libphp5.so
的权限!或者你

改为
LoadModule php5_module /usr/local/httpd/modules/libphp5.so
AddType application/x-httpd-php .php .phtml
看下
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
时迈瞿梓彤
2019-09-25 · TA获得超过1250个赞
知道小有建树答主
回答量:1497
采纳率:91%
帮助的人:6.7万
展开全部
libphp5.so是php5提供的,你还需要编译php5才能生成这个文件
你在php的configure的时候,加上:
--with-apxs2=/usr/local/apache/bin/apxs
这样就会自动编译一个libphp5.so出来了。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
木子小三5f
2010-03-26 · TA获得超过3468个赞
知道小有建树答主
回答量:1299
采纳率:0%
帮助的人:1321万
展开全部
原因不了解,大概说的是无法打开文件,目标文件不存在。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
收起 更多回答(2)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式